Thexchangefunding.com, a recently established website, is under suspicion for operating as a crypto exchange scam. The domain name, merely 145 days old at the time of this report, shows signs of fraudulent activity. The phone numbers provided on the site are non-operational, and the business address listed is misleading as no such business exists there. Furthermore, the business name lacks registration in the state it purports to operate from. The company’s social media accounts have zero followers, and a search across popular consumer review websites yields no reviews for the company.

A crypto exchange scam involves a fraudulent website that pretends to offer cryptocurrency exchange services. They often provide false contact information and business details, and lack any real customer feedback or social media presence.

A crypto exchange scam involves fraudulent platforms that pose as cryptocurrency exchanges. These scams lure investors with promises of high returns and low fees. Scammers often use sophisticated websites and convincing marketing tactics. They may even offer referral bonuses to encourage victims to recruit others. These fraudulent exchanges often lack transparency. They may not disclose their location, or the identities of their team members. Once the victims deposit their cryptocurrencies, the scammers run off with the funds. Victims are left without any means to recover their investment. In some cases, they may even find themselves locked out of their accounts. Always remember, if it sounds too good to be true, it probably is.
